From d2eccd7515323f402059361719f0644e6fae028e Mon Sep 17 00:00:00 2001 From: piernov Date: Tue, 25 Oct 2011 22:39:55 +0200 Subject: webkit 1.6.1-2 ajout webkitgtk-1.0 --- extra/webkit/Pkgfile | 38 +++++++++++++++++++++++++++++--------- 1 file changed, 29 insertions(+), 9 deletions(-) (limited to 'extra/webkit/Pkgfile') diff --git a/extra/webkit/Pkgfile b/extra/webkit/Pkgfile index d4205aa2c..fc53c318b 100755 --- a/extra/webkit/Pkgfile +++ b/extra/webkit/Pkgfile @@ -7,22 +7,45 @@ name=webkit version=1.6.1 -release=1 +release=2 source=(http://webkitgtk.org/$name-$version.tar.gz) build() { - unset MAKEFLAGS - cd $name-$version + cp -r $name-$version $name-3-$version + cd $name-$version PYTHON=/usr/bin/python2 ./configure --prefix=/usr \ + --sysconfdir=/etc \ --localstatedir=/var \ --enable-introspection \ - --with-font-backend=freetype \ - --disable-gtk-doc \ + --enable-video \ --enable-jit \ - --sysconfdir=/etc \ + --disable-schemas-compile \ + --with-font-backend=freetype \ --with-unicode-backend=icu \ + --with-gtk=2.0 + make + make DESTDIR=$PKG install + mkdir $PKG/usr/lib/$name + install -m755 Programs/GtkLauncher $PKG/usr/lib/$name + + cd $SRC/$name-3-$version + PYTHON=/usr/bin/python2 ./configure --prefix=/usr \ + --sysconfdir=/etc \ + --localstatedir=/var \ + --enable-introspection \ + --enable-video \ + --enable-jit \ --disable-schemas-compile \ + --with-font-backend=freetype \ + --with-unicode-backend=icu \ + --with-gtk=3.0 + make + make DESTDIR=$PKG install + mkdir $PKG/usr/lib/${name}3 + install -m755 Programs/GtkLauncher $PKG/usr/lib/${name}3 +} + # --enable-3d-rendering \ # --enable-webgl \ # --enable-channel-messaging \ @@ -77,6 +100,3 @@ build() { # --enable-video-track \ # --enable-media-stream # --enable-web-audio \ - make -j1 - make DESTDIR=$PKG install -} -- cgit v1.2.3-70-g09d2 From 544aaf170a0dc1637a33735711580023c234dae7 Mon Sep 17 00:00:00 2001 From: piernov Date: Wed, 26 Oct 2011 15:33:01 +0200 Subject: webkit 1.6.1-2 correction port --- extra/webkit/Pkgfile |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'extra/webkit/Pkgfile') diff --git a/extra/webkit/Pkgfile b/extra/webkit/Pkgfile index fc53c318b..012b37f63 100755 --- a/extra/webkit/Pkgfile +++ b/extra/webkit/Pkgfile @@ -11,10 +11,11 @@ release=2 source=(http://webkitgtk.org/$name-$version.tar.gz) build() { + export PYTHON=/usr/bin/python2 cp -r $name-$version $name-3-$version cd $name-$version - PYTHON=/usr/bin/python2 ./configure --prefix=/usr \ + ./configure --prefix=/usr \ --sysconfdir=/etc \ --localstatedir=/var \ --enable-introspection \ @@ -30,7 +31,7 @@ build() { install -m755 Programs/GtkLauncher $PKG/usr/lib/$name cd $SRC/$name-3-$version - PYTHON=/usr/bin/python2 ./configure --prefix=/usr \ + ./configure --prefix=/usr \ --sysconfdir=/etc \ --localstatedir=/var \ --enable-introspection \ -- cgit v1.2.3-70-g09d2